#1438bc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#1438bc is composed of 7.8% red, 22% green and 73.7%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 89.4% cyan, 70.2% magenta, 0% yellow and 26.3% black. It has a hue angle of 227.1 degrees, a saturation of 80.8% and a lightness of 40.8%. #1438bc color hex could be obtained by blending #2870ff with #000079. Closest websafe color is: #0033cc.

#1438bc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#1438bc has RGB values of R:20, G:56, B:188 and CMYK values of C:0.89, M:0.7, Y:0, K:0.26. Its decimal value is 1325244.

Shades and Tints of #1438bc
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#01030b is the darkest color, while #f8f9fe is the lightest one.

Tones of #1438bc
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#64666c is the less saturated color, while #042fcc is the most saturated one.
